javascript - 用Javascript模拟浏览器地址栏

标签 javascript jquery html css

我需要一个模拟浏览器地址栏的 html 控件。

例如,如果我输入“www.google.com”,我想自动添加前缀“http://” 或者建议后缀.com。此外,能够控制它的历史。

你知道一个 jQuery 插件吗?或者如何使用 css 和 javascript 完成?

最佳答案

可以使用html/css/js来完成

我建议使用 jQuery 获取 html 表单字段的值。检查是否有 http:///添加它对于 Javascript 来说真的不是什么大问题。

我想,您想使用 Ajax 发送请求吗?请注意,您不能简单地加载您想要显示它们的任何页面外部页面,例如在 iframe 中。 see here

最后但同样重要的是,jQuery this插件可以帮助您了解您的历史记录。

不要害怕自己尝试,而不是浪费太多时间寻找你想要拥有的完美插件。互联网上充满了如何使用 JS 获取元素的值或更改其值的示例。模拟地址栏应该没什么大不了的。

关于javascript - 用Javascript模拟浏览器地址栏,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9273705/

相关文章:

javascript - 如何在没有钩子(Hook)的情况下动态添加图像或链接?

javascript - 将 javascript 作用域传递给函数

javascript - 使用 javascript 为图像分配链接

javascript - 将类分配给相同绑定(bind)数据的所有元素

javascript - Famo.us:如何将表单字段放入适用​​于 iOS 和 Safari 的 ScrollView 中?

javascript - 如果句子包含字符串

javascript - 使用引导下拉子菜单

javascript - 使用 jquery-pjax 时如何强制一个链接进行整页加载

javascript - JQuery 输入 radio 只能工作一次

javascript - 对象 [] 表示法